本文围绕TP类(即移动/桌面端托管/非托管)钱包在现实运营中的关键议题,逐项解读并给出可行建议,旨在帮助产品、运维与安全团队构建更稳健的用户体验。

1. 高可用性
定义与目标:高可用性指钱包服务在面向用户的持续可用性与快速恢复能力。对TP钱包包括:节点冗余、RPC池化、后端服务拆分、缓存与退路策略(fallback RPC、离线签名队列)。

风险与实践:单点RPC或签名服务故障会导致交易延迟或失败。建议采用多地域、多提供商的RPC节点、连接池限速、熔断器与灰度发布;并为移动端实现本地事务队列与重试策略,保证短时网络波动时体验可控。
2. 合约异常
类型与检测:合约异常包含调用失败、重入问题、存储越界、逻辑升级漏洞及预言机异常。对于TP钱包,常见表现为交易回滚、估算Gas异常或签名后时间窗失效。
对策:集成合约审计结果、调用前进行静态/符号检查(例如ABI兼容性、非预期返回值)、模拟器(testnet/sandbox)预执行与异常分类上报;当检测到高风险合约时做风险提示或阻断签名流程。
3. 行业监测报告
内容与价值:监测报告应包含链上交易异常、费率波动、跨链桥状态、已知合约风险与黑名单、节点健康指标。对TP钱包有助于风控、客服与产品决策。
实现要点:数据来源多元化(链上接口、桥方公告、第三方情报),建立告警等级与自动化响应。例如:当检测到某桥暂停或大量回滚,应触发用户通知、暂停相关资产流动并启动人工排查。
4. 高效能技术应用
方向:性能优化既包括链上交互效率,也包括客户端渲染与加密操作。采用异步签名流水、并行RPC请求、轻量化加密库(注意安全性)、批量交易与Gas估算缓存,可显著减少延时与资源消耗。
工程实践:使用流控与限流策略保护后端,基于Prometheus/Grafana做端到端性能监控,并通过灰度与A/B测试验证优化效果。
5. 跨链资产
挑战:跨链操作牵涉桥合约托管模型、验证者延迟、资产封装(wrapped token)可信度以及链间最终性差异。风险包括资产被锁定、桥方被攻陷或跨链事件造成的重复消费。
建议:支持主流且有审计的跨链方案,提供桥方信誉评分、对用户展示桥延迟与手续费预估;在用户资产跨链前提供明确风险提示与回滚策略。
6. 手续费率
动态性:手续费受网络拥堵、优先级与Gas策略影响。Wallet端需提供费率分层(慢/标准/快)与透明估算,并允许高级用户自定义Gas策略。
降费策略:支持代付、手续费代估(meta-tx)、批量代发与聚合交易(when supported),并对手续费敏感场景提供Gas补偿或推荐低峰转移时间窗口。
结语:TP钱包要在竞争中保持用户信任,需要把高可用架构、合约异常管控、即时行业监测、高效能实现、跨链安全与合理手续费体系统一纳入产品与运维流程。通过自动化监控、风险分级与用户可视化说明,可在安全与体验之间取得平衡。
评论
AlexChen
写得很实用,关于跨链风险的建议尤其中肯。
区块小白
对新手很友好,合约异常那部分学到了不少。
Maya
希望能出一份配套的技术实施清单,方便落地执行。
辰风
行业监测报告设计思路很清晰,值得参考。